PARKING BRAKE LEVER
REMOVAL
(1) Remove the shift knob from the shifter. The
shift knob is attached to the shifter using a set
screw (Fig. 122). Access to the set screw is from
the front of the shift knob and is removed using
a 2 mm allen wrench.
(2) Remove the 3 screws (Fig. 123) attaching the
rear of the center console to the console bracket.

(3) Remove the shift range indicator from the cen-
ter console. The shift range indicator is attached to
the center console using retaining clips. It is removed
by carefully prying it off the center console. The shift
range indicator covers the 2 screws attaching the
center console to the shifter mechanism. (Fig. 124).
(4) Remove the 2 screws (Fig. 125) attaching the
center console to the shifter.
(5) Raise the park brake hand lever to approxi-
mately a 45° angle. This is for the required clearance
to remove the center console.
(6) Raise the rear of the center console high
enough to access the center console wiring harness
connector (Fig. 126). Disconnect the center console
wiring harness connector from the vehicle wiring
harness 10 way connector (Fig. 126).
(7) Remove the center console from the vehicle.
(8) Lower park brake lever handle.
WARNING: THE AUTO ADJUSTING FEATURE OF
THIS PARK BRAKE LEVER CONTAINS A CLOCK
SPRING LOADED TO APPROXIMATELY 20 POUNDS.
DO NOT RELEASE THE PARK BRAKE CABLES
FROM
THE
EQUALIZER
UNTIL
THE
AUTO
ADJUSTER IS RELOADED. FAILURE TO RELOAD
THE ADJUSTER MECHANISM BEFORE REMOVING
PARK BRAKE CABLES FROM EQUALIZER COULD
RESULT IN SERIOUS INJURY.
(9) Reload the adjuster mechanism on the park
brake lever using the following procedure.
• Ensure the park brake lever is in the full down
position when attempting to pull on park brake
lever output cable (Fig. 127).
• Grasp the park brake lever output cable (Fig.
127) by hand and pull upward.
• Continue to pull upward on cable until a 15/64
drill bit can be inserted in the adjuster mechanism
as shown in (Fig. 127). This will lock-out the auto
adjuster mechanism removing the tension from the
park brake lever output cable. This will then allow
the rear park brake cables to be easily removed from
the equalizer.

NOTE: If the output cable of the park brake mech-
anism will not move when pulled on, first, be sure
the park brake lever is in the full down position. If
park brake lever is in the full down position and the
output cable will not move, use the following proce-
dure to reload the adjuster mechanism.
Using a screw driver (Fig. 128) push down on the
end of the clutch spring where shown (Fig. 128).
While end of clutch spring is held down, pull out-
ward on park brake mechanism output cable.
If output cable can not be pulled out of park
brake mechanism, by pulling directly on output
cable, use a screwdriver inserted in tension equal-
izer (Fig. 128) to assist in pulling on cable.
(10) Remove the rear wheel park brake cables
from the park brake cable tension equalizer (Fig.
129).
NOTE: If auto adjuster was not reloaded before
removing the tension equalizer from both rear park
brake cables, (Fig. 128) the park brake lever output
cable (Fig. 128) will be pulled into the park brake
mechanism.
If this happens the auto adjuster can be reloaded
using the following procedure.
Using a screw driver (Fig. 128) push down on the
end of the clutch spring where shown (Fig. 128).
While the end of the clutch spring is held down,
pull outward on park brake mechanism output
cable. If output cable can not be pulled out of park
brake mechanism, by pulling directly on output
cable, use a screwdriver inserted in tension equal-
izer (Fig. 128) to assist in pulling on cable.
(11) Disconnect
the
wiring
harness
from
the
ground switch on the park brake lever (Fig. 130).
(12) Remove the wiring harness routing clips from
both sides of the park brake mechanism bracket.
Move the wiring harnesses out of the way.
NOTE: The mounting holes in the park brake lever
bracket are slotted, which requires the mounting
bolts to only be loosened but not removed.

(13) Loosen but do not remove the 4 bolts
attaching the park brake lever to the console bracket
(Fig. 131).
(14) Remove the park brake lever assembly from
console bracket using the following procedure. First
rotate the back of the lever bracket upward off the 2
rear mounting bolts, then slide the lever bracket
rearward off the front mounting bolts.
INSTALLATION
NOTE: If the parking brake lever mounting bolts are
not installed in the console bracket install them
before installing the park brake lever on the con-
sole bracket.
(1) Install the parking brake lever on the console
bracket using the following procedure. First slide the
front of the park brake lever bracket on the 2 for-
ward mounting bolts, then rotate the rear of the
bracket downward onto the 2 rear mounting bolts.
Tighten the 4 attaching bolts (Fig. 131) to a torque of
24 N·m (20 ft. lbs.).
(2) Install the rear park brake cables on the park
brake cable tension equalizer (Fig. 129).
WARNING: THE AUTO ADJUSTING FEATURE OF
THIS PARK BRAKE LEVER CONTAINS A CLOCK
SPRING LOADED TO APPROXIMATELY 20 POUNDS.
DO NOT UNLOAD THE ADJUSTER MECHANISM
USING A PROCEDURE OTHER THEN THE PROCE-
DURE
IN
Step
3
FAILURE
TO
UNLOAD
THE
ADJUSTER MECHANISM USING AN ALTERNATE
PROCEDURE COULD RESULT IN SERIOUS INJURY.
(3) Unload the adjuster mechanism on the park
brake lever using the following procedure.
• Ensure the park brake lever is in the full down
position when attempting to pull on park brake
lever output cable (Fig. 127).
• Grasp the park brake lever output cable by hand
and pull upward until all tension is removed from
the drill bit used to reload the adjuster mechanism
(Fig. 127).
• Remove the drill bit from the adjuster mecha-
nism of the park brake lever (Fig. 127).
• Slowly release the park brake lever output cable
until all slack is removed from the cable.
(4) Clip the wiring harness to the park brake lever
bracket.
(5) Install the wiring harness connector on the
ground switch of the park brake lever (Fig. 130).
(6) Cycle the park brake lever once from the
released position to the fully applied position and
then back to the released position. This will position
the park brake cables and fully adjust them to their
proper tension.
(7) Check the rear wheels of the vehicle with the
park brake lever fully released, they should rotate
freely without dragging.
(8) Raise the park brake hand lever to approxi-
mately a 45° angle. This is necessary for the required
clearance to install the center console.
(9) Install the center console back in the vehicle.
(10) Install the wiring harness connector for the
center console into the vehicle wiring harness (Fig.
126).
(11) Install the 2 screws attaching the front of the
center console to the shifter. (Fig. 125).
(12) Install the 3 screws attaching the rear of the
console to the console bracket (Fig. 123).
(13) Install the transmission range indicator (Fig.
124) in the center console.
